titleOfInvention | Method for detecting diabetic nephropathy |
abstract | The present invention provides a method for detecting diabetic nephropathy, which includes step (a) detecting the expression amount of apoprotein A4 adsorbed by concanavalin A (Con A) in a plasma sample of an individual to be tested; and (b) Compare the expression amount of Concanavalin A adsorbed apolipoprotein A4 in the plasma sample of the tested individual with the Concanavalin A adsorbed apolipoprotein A4 reference substance; wherein the Concanavalin A adsorbed by the tested individual When the expression level of apolipoprotein A4 is higher than that of concanavalin A adsorbed to apolipoprotein A4 control substance, the individual to be tested has the risk of suffering from diabetic nephropathy. |
